For years, Bournemouth have been the butt of many jokes with regards to the size of the Vitality Stadium, but in interviews today, owner Bill Foley has confirmed the approximate timescales for a NEW build, which would see an increased capacity, increased hospitality, and the possibility for expansion.
In this video, Sam and Tom discuss where it will be, when it will happen, whether the increase is enough, as well as the other talking points that emanates from his interviews on Talksport and BBC Sounds.
